7.7 Exhaust Turbocharger

7.7.1 Compressor wheel – Cleaning
Preconditions
☑ Engine is stopped and starting disabled.
Special tools, Material, Spare parts
Designation / Use
Cold cleaner
WARNING
Compressed air gun ejects a jet of pressurized air.
Risk of injury to eyes and damage to hearing, risk of rupturing internal organs!
• Never direct air jet at people.
• Always wear safety goggles/face mask and ear defenders.
WARNING
Chemical substances.
Risk of irritation and chemical burns!
• Observe the instructions of the cleaning agent manufacturer.
NOTICE
Incorrect installation of electric lines .
Damage to component!
• Note down line assignment to connections before removal.
NOTICE
Inappropriate cleaning tool.
Risk of damage to component!
• Observe manufacturer's instructions.
• Use appropriate cleaning tool.
Preparatory steps
1.
Drain engine coolant (→ Page 158).
2.
Remove air filter (→ Page 141).
3.
Remove exhaust system after exhaust turbocharger.
4.
Remove exhaust flap with actuators.
5.
Remove air intake.
Compressor wheel – Cleaning
Note:
Do not use wire brush, scraper or similar tools for cleaning!
1.
Clean compressor housing with paint brush or smooth brush.
2.
Clean compressor wheel and bearing housing with cold cleaner.
3.
Thoroughly blow out all parts with compressed air to remove cold cleaner.
